The Role of Artificial Intelligence in Revolutionizing Smart Home Apps

Unlocking the Future: The Role of Artificial Intelligence in Revolutionizing Smart Home Apps

In this digital age, artificial intelligence is being used to automate smart homes, making our houses more intelligent. People’s interactions with their living environments are significantly altered by this change, which makes them safer, more effective, and more convenient.

This blog will examine the incredible advancements in home automation made possible by artificial intelligence. We will discuss about how future smart home technologies will impact daily chores, such as lighting, thermostat control, security systems,  entertainment management, and more. Discover how AI systems can generate responsive, personalized, and customized living environments by adapting and learning to your preferences.

Join us as we investigate the endless possibilities of AI in smart homes. Regardless of whether you are a tech enthusiast or just interested in what the future of home living holds, this blog will assist you in creating a linked artificial intelligence at home. You can hire mobile app developers to assist you with the smart tech and advancements for integrating Artificial Intelligence in smart home apps. 

Let’s begin this thrilling journey!

Smart Home Automation: What?

The integration of devices and current technology to beautify consolation, performance, safety, and comfort is known as clever domestic automation. The secret is to attach all your appliances, systems, and gadgets—along with audio system, cameras, and thermostats—to a relevant hub. You can use voice commands, a smartphone, or other methods to access this hub.

Homeowners can remotely monitor security, optimize energy use, control lighting, and automate other chores like temperature adjustments and lighting management thanks to this networked system.

AI for Secure Homes

Enhancing house security is among the most common applications of artificial intelligence in home design that individuals have discovered. Devices featuring a range of characteristics, such as threat analysis and facial recognition,  integrate this technology. The device can identify faces and things and may notify users about who is at the front door. Advanced artificial intelligence devices can already identify the faces of friends, family, and even pets thanks to facial recognition technology. It won’t be long before neighborhood activity is monitored by AI-powered smart cameras, which will use AI reasoning to identify possible risks. Moreover, smart locks that can be accessed via mobile devices have also been made using artificial intelligence.

AI for Safer Homes

There are already smoke alarms with AI on the market. With their intelligent features, they can alert, communicate, and even think for themselves to stop fires and carbon monoxide leaks. Owners can interact with their smart smoke alarms by installing mobile apps on their cell phones. They can send out several kinds of alerts about battery life, smoke, carbon monoxide leakage, and even the location of possible fire or smoke outbreaks.

Artificial Intelligence for smart kitchens

Smart kitchens save users from accidents caused by overcooking or undercooking meals. These days, smart stoves and ovens are more than just ideas. They’ve moved into our homes and are making cooking easier and faster. Additionally, apps can let users know when to take food out of the oven or burner. Even before the user gets home, it can begin the preheating process.

Artificial Intelligence for energy storage

Distributed energy generation involves the application of artificial intelligence. This is because it combines dispersed energy sources and automated energy storage devices to store and utilize electricity. Furthermore, smart houses can continue to receive energy even in the event of a power outage, thanks to the technology’s ability to store electricity in energy storage systems. Stated differently, energy storage made possible by artificial intelligence (AI) will make it simpler for smart houses to become off the grid and reduce their energy costs.

Example: Nest Learning Thermostat.

Artificial intelligence and smart voice assistants

AI-enabled devices like Alexa, Siri, and Google Assistant are applied to perform distinctive clever domestic structures with voice instructions. The captivating aspect is that your AI-powered helpers will learn from their mistakes and enhance whenever. It will also change! Using the accompanying data from your queries, your voice assistant learns from mistakes and strives to provide a helpful response. 

Example: Amazon Echo with Alexa and Google Home with Google Assistant.

How Can I Make an AI App for Smart Home Automation?

Making an AI smart home application is a fantastic way to make consumers’ lives better. These ten steps will help you create artificial intelligence for smart home automation. 

Step 1: Identify Your Objectives and Vision:

Before you start with smart home app development, decide on its objectives. Choose the desires you need to obtain along with your clever domestic app. Which is more crucial to you, comfort or power efficiency? The AI used in smart home automation starts with this phase.

Step 2: Market Research:

Conduct in-intensity marketplace studies to identify your goal marketplace, competitors, and emerging tendencies inside the smart home automation region. Recognizing the necessities and preferences of your users is the key.

Step 3: Budget and Resource Allocation: 

Hiring developers, designers, and different crew members is a part of the price of growing a cellular app. Make sensible resource allocations to guarantee project success. Consider elements like infrastructure, maintenance, and the technological stack to find out how much developing a home service app will cost.

Step 4: Selecting a Knowledgeable Development Group:

An improvement group with know-how in AI, IoT, and mobile app development is needed for a clever domestic automation application. Employ committed developers and UX/UX designers with prior experience creating apps of a comparable nature. Employ companies that can comprehend your concept and function as a cohesive team to design mobile apps. 

Step 5: Pick the Correct Technology Stack:

Decide which technology stack best fits the needs of developing home service apps. You can accomplish this by selecting the appropriate tools, frameworks, databases, and programming languages. Think approximately technology like cloud structures like AWS and Azure, IoT platforms, gadget getting to know libraries (PyTorch and TensorFlow), and IoT protocols (MQTT and CoAP).

Step 6: Design User Interfaces and Experience:

Users need to be able to have interaction with the app with no trouble if the interface is apparent and easy to apply. Paying interest to UI/UX will guarantee that the chatbot app development is each aesthetically desirable and consumer-pleasant. When creating wireframes and prototypes, involve UI/UX designers.

Step 7: Create Core Features:

Create the essential features for your on-demand home services application to automate your smart home. User registration, device pairing, remote controls, and automation protocols are a few examples. Develop machine learning models to carry out operations like predictive maintenance, personalized recommendations, and speech recognition.

Step 8: Integrate with IoT and Smart Devices: 

Only with the assistance of AI Development service providers is this step achievable. Integrate your AI with IoT protocols and smart home automation systems. Ensure that the AI smart home gadgets are compatible with well-known platforms such as Apple HomeKit and Amazon Alexa. Test the communication between your application and several devices to make sure everything works smoothly.

Step 9: AI and Data Analytics: 

Create and improve AI algorithms to fuel your smart home application’s intelligent features. Artificial Intelligence plays a crucial role in smart home automation, be it for security analysis, personalization, or energy optimization. To enhance artificial intelligence (AI) devices for home models, data from linked devices can be gathered and processed.

Step 10: Evaluate, Adjust, and Release:

Make sure the Web development company you worked with has conducted extensive testing after identifying and resolving any bugs, security issues, or usability issues. Ask beta testers for their opinions so you can learn important things. This feedback will assist you in making your app better. When you are happy with the outcome, launch your smart home automation software from the app store.


As AI technology becomes more widely used, smart homes are evolving to become more creative, safe, convenient, and energy-efficient. AI-enabled gadgets give homeowners more personalization options and control over their living environments. This technology has also improved the safety and security of our houses while saving energy and benefiting the environment. Future smart homes will be much more advanced and responsive as AI technology develops, significantly enhancing our quality of life.